deemixer/src/components/BaseLoadingPlaceholder.vue

32 lines
524 B
Vue
Raw Normal View History

<template functional>
<div :id="props.id" class="loading_placeholder" v-show="!props.hidden">
<span class="loading_placeholder__text">{{ props.text }}</span>
<div class="lds-ring">
<div></div>
<div></div>
<div></div>
<div></div>
</div>
</div>
</template>
<script>
export default {
props: {
text: {
type: String,
required: false,
default: 'Loading...'
},
id: {
type: String,
required: false
2020-07-18 16:06:07 +00:00
},
hidden: {
type: Boolean,
required: false,
default: false
}
}
}
</script>